What it actually says
You are resuming a Ringmaster session. Follow the pickup / resume flow in
${CLAUDE_PLUGIN_ROOT}/skills/orchestrator/references/state-and-resume.md exactly:
- Read
.ringmaster/state.jsonand.ringmaster/PROGRESS.md. If neither exists, say so plainly and offer to start fresh — do not invent a ledger. - Validate:
python "${CLAUDE_PLUGIN_ROOT}/hooks/ledger.py" validate .ringmaster/state.json(usepython3orpyifpythonisn't on PATH). If it reports problems, surface them and ask before proceeding. - Reconcile (trust but verify): run read-only
git status/git diff --stat, confirm the recordedfilesTouchedstill exist, and detect drift (files moved, tasks completed elsewhere, new commits). If anything is ambiguous, flag it and ask before resuming; update the ledger to match reality. - Print a compact resume briefing (goal; done / in-progress / pending / blocked
counts; key decisions; the next task) using the block in
${CLAUDE_PLUGIN_ROOT}/skills/orchestrator/references/output-style.md. - Select the next task (
python "${CLAUDE_PLUGIN_ROOT}/hooks/ledger.py" next .ringmaster/state.json, or the documented algorithm) and continue it through the normal orchestrator pipeline — behind the stage-1 approval gate if it is substantial.
Honor every safety rail. Stage, never commit.
